Un-sink the cross-examination

What is cross-examination? The examination of a witness by the party opposed to the party who has first examined him, in order to test the truth of such first or direct examination, which is called examination in chief. ‘Opportunity to Cross-examine’ includes the method of cross interrogatories. This interpretation laid in the decided case of  QE v Ramachandra 19 Bom 749. During the cross examination, …

Environmental Crime under the Environment Quality Act 1974

Environmental crime can be considered as a perpetration of harms against the environment and human health that violate the law. Thus, it differs considerably from the traditional criminal model that focuses on crimes against persons and private property.
